Output e28e61e57d1d4581d6176283db9d186488753fcd72f7d43ddd623990a443ceaf:5

value
300929923
script pubkey
OP_0 OP_PUSHBYTES_20 3f873b71061f893fc66f50a1670b6e4d399fc246
address
bc1q87rnkugxr7ynl3n02zskwzmwf5uelsjxft29jl
transaction
e28e61e57d1d4581d6176283db9d186488753fcd72f7d43ddd623990a443ceaf
spent
true